To use just one resource rather than both simply restricts the ability to find useful information. Given that seeking information on the internet can produce inaccurate data, using several resources will help to confirm the validity of information on a site.
It is always worth remembering that a wiki can be edited by anyone. Although many have very useful and accurate information, it is always wise to confirm the information with comparisons to other sources.
